Timothy Bartlett

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Timothy Bartlett is a New Zealand stage, television and film actor who is best known for presenting TVNZ's Playschool in the 1980s,[1] and playing Bernie Leach in Shortland Street in the mid-1990s.[2] He first appeared in professional theatre for Auckland's Theatre Corporate in 1974.[3] He has also appeared in An Angel at My Table,[4] Soldier Soldier, The Tommyknockers, Duggan, Holby City, Out of the Blue, The Hobbit: An Unexpected Journey and The Hobbit: The Battle of the Five Armies.[5]
